Abstract
PURPOSE: To eliminate the need for vacuum pumps without lowering the amt. of gaseous N2 in products by removing he gaseous mixture in an adsorption tower, evacuating the tower inside and feeding the gaseous mixture to an adsorption tower prior to adsorption process in separation of N2 and O2 in air and the like.
CONSTITUTION: Pressurized raw material air and the like is fed into an adsorption tower 11, where the O2 which is an easy to adsorb component is adsorbed and the N2 which is a difficult-to-absorb component is concd. and is fed into a tank 26. The gaseous mixture left in an adsorption tower 13 are discharged into a discharge pipe 23, and the inside of said tower is subjected to a primary evacuation and further to a secondary evacuation. The gaseous mixture in the pipe 23 are fed into an adsorption tower 12, and while the gases in the tower 12 are scavenged, the O2 adsorbed on an adsorbent 12a is desorbed and is discharged through a main discharge pipe 6. Thence, N2 is reflowed into the tower 12 from the tank 26, so that the inside of the tower is boosted up to prescribed pressure. In the towers 11, 12, 13, the adsorption, evacuation, desorption and boosting are repeated successively at deviated timings.
